We are seeking an Employment Specialist to provide community-based supported employment services to adults with a severe and persistent mental illness. A good team fit would be an individual who is motivated, energetic, positive and creative. The ideal applicant will be recovery-oriented and committed to identifying and working to overcome barriers to employment; someone who can balance patience with “go-getting”. We are looking for someone who can inspire hope as well as nurture relationships with clients and employers simultaneously. Responsibilities will include significant job developing by networking with local businesses and fostering positive relationships with community partners, career counseling, vocational assessments and placement supports. Strong organizational and communication skills and the ability to work with an interdisciplinary team are required. A Bachelor’s degree is preferred, however an Associate’s degree and/or relevant experience will be considered.
